Research Abstract |
Most of silica fume used in Japan are imported silica fume.As very small amount of silica fume is produced in Japan, it is expected silica fume concrete to be high (or very high) performance concrete in Japan. It means that silica fume concrete should have many good properties such as high strength, high durability and high workability. So, it is necessary to know which characteristics of silica fume relates to the properties of concrete. The purpose of this research program is to find out the influence of the characteristics of 13 kinds of silica fumes, which were on the market in Japan during 1991-1992, as concrete admixtures considering. Through this study, following conclusions were clarified ; 1) There are some correlations among physical and chemical properties of silica fume, such as correlation between siO_2 and alkali content. 2) Early hydration of cement paste was accelerated by using silica fume. 3) W/C,moisture content and SiO_2 content of silica fume are the two main factors on compressive strength of concrete containing silica fume. But the effect of superplasticizer was very strong. 4) Reducing effect of silica fume on the concrete expansion due to A.S.R.(Alkali-Silica Reaction) could be evaluated by alkali content of silica fume.
